Bitcoin Block 503658

Bitcoin Block 503,658 was mined on and contains 891 transactions. Miners collected 3.29459656 BTC in transaction fees with a block reward of 15.79459656 BTC. Block size: 1.03 MB.

Block Details

Hash0000000000000000007d29e6a3498ecdaa2a3cd7fc9ddf6be20e0e1f507cf397
Timestamp
Transactions891
AddressesView addresses
Size1.03 MB
Weight3,992,888 WU
Total fees3.29459656 BTC
Avg fee rate330.1 sat/vB
Block reward15.79459656 BTC
Inputs / Outputs6,121 / 2,464
SegWit txs138 (15.5%)
RBF signaling42 (4.7%)
Difficulty1.93e+12
Merkle root520ac14d66977f2e964dc1f8ab6273e42fe1ad9df1e14ddb8f28d2ba40d46602
Nonce518,359,653
Version0x20000000
Previous block0000000000000000001304dcd40bc31bb8dd64197ab239b64763d43157540a9e
Next blockBlock 503659 →

Block Visualization

Block Statistics

See how this block compares to network trends: